1. An elliptical prosthetic valve comprising:

  • an elliptical support means having a longitudinal axis, an interior surface and an outer surface, the interior surface defining an internal lumen containing the longitudinal axis, the elliptical support means configured to conduct fluid flow through the internal lumen, and the outer surface having an elliptical cross-sectional shape, the outer surface intersecting a first radial axis at a first distance and intersecting a second radial axis perpendicular to the first radial axis at a second distance that is less than the first distance, the first radial axis and the second radial axis being perpendicular to the longitudinal axis;

    wherein the elliptical support means comprises an elliptical ring comprising a first pair of collapse points positioned at the points of intersection of the first radial axis with the elliptical ring;

    the elliptical ring moveable from a planar configuration bisected by a first plane containing the first radial axis and the second radial axis, to a bent configuration by bending the planar elliptical ring at the first pair of collapse points while moving the points of intersection of the elliptical ring with the second radial axis out of the first plane; and

    a means for regulating fluid flow through the internal lumen, the means for regulating fluid flow being attached to the elliptical ring.
